An additional AOE is created by a ranged attack when specified by the ranged attack's description. It usually deviates from the center of the first AOE in one of three directions as described in the attack's text: On a roll of 1 or 2, the additional deviates in direction 1. On a roll of 3 or 4, it deviates in direction 2. On a roll of 5 or 6, it deviates in direction 6.
Rules Clarifications
- Additional AOE (Edit)
- The special rule states what the blast damage POW is - you don't need to halve it a second time.
- If the deviation distance is short and the AOEs end up overlapping a model, that model will take a damage roll for each AOE it's in.
- The distance of the second deviation is a d6 roll, unless the rule on the card specifies otherwise (Infernal Ruling).
- If you have an ability to reroll deviation (such as Artillerist) then you can reroll each additional AOE independent of the others.
- If the deviation direction of the additional AOEs is limited (such as Bounce) then the direction of the reroll is limited too. (Infernal Ruling)
- The additional AOEs are treated as if they "came from the weapon" exactly the same as the first AOE.
- If the weapon has Damage Type: Magical, then the additional AOEs will do magical damage too. (Infernal Ruling)
- If the weapon has a bonus to damage rolls (such as Bring It Down or Fire for Effect) then the additional AOEs will too. (Infernal Ruling)
- If the weapon has something which modifies its blast damage (such as Full Force or High-Explosive), then that modifier will apply to the additional AOE blast damage too. (Infernal Ruling)
